The fourth film in the Mission: Impossible franchise is titled Mission: Impossible – Ghost Protocol. Directed by Brad Bird and starring Tom Cruise, it is widely considered one of the best entries in the series due to its high-stakes action and iconic stunts. Plot Overview
After a bombing at the Kremlin, the Impossible Missions Force (IMF) is implicated as international terrorists. The President initiates "Ghost Protocol," effectively shutting down the agency and leaving Ethan Hunt and his team to go rogue. To clear their name and stop a plot to start a nuclear war, the team must operate without backup or official support, relying solely on their wits and high-tech gear. Directed by Brad Bird, the fourth installment of the franchise revitalized the series with high-stakes action and cutting-edge technology.
The Plot: Ethan Hunt (Tom Cruise) and his team are blamed for a terrorist bombing of the Kremlin. The U.S. government initiates "Ghost Protocol," disavowing the entire IMF. Ethan must go rogue with a new team to clear their names and stop a nuclear extremist.
The Highlight: This film features the iconic sequence where Tom Cruise actually climbs the Burj Khalifa in Dubai, the world's tallest building.
Critical Reception: It is widely considered one of the best in the series, holding high ratings on platforms like Rotten Tomatoes for its near-perfect pacing and thrills. The Risks of Using Sites Like Filmyzilla
Sites like Filmyzilla are third-party, unofficial platforms. Using them presents several dangers:
Malware and Viruses: These sites often hide malicious scripts in "Download" buttons that can infect your device, steal personal data, or install ransomware.
Intrusive Ads: You are likely to encounter aggressive pop-ups and redirects to gambling or adult websites. Malware and Viruses : Piracy sites often host
Legal Issues: Downloading copyrighted material from unauthorized sources is illegal in many jurisdictions and can result in penalties from internet service providers.
Poor Quality: The files are often low-resolution "cam" versions or have distorted audio, ruining the cinematic experience intended by the filmmakers. Where to Watch Safely

Ghost Protocol solidified the "team dynamic." Jeremy Renner’s Brandt, Simon Pegg’s Benji, and Paula Patton’s Jane formed a chemistry that carried the next three sequels.
The availability of films like Ghost Protocol on torrent sites undermines the hard work of thousands of crew members. Action films of this scale require massive budgets (the film had a budget of approximately $145 million). Revenue loss due to piracy affects the film industry's ability to greenlight future projects and fairly compensate the technical staff who make the stunts possible.
Furthermore, downloading a compressed version of Ghost Protocol significantly degrades the viewing experience. The film was shot in IMAX format; watching a pixelated, low-bitrate torrent file fails to capture the visual grandeur intended by the director.
